Is there any way to do 128-bit shifts on gcc <4.4?

gcc 4.4 seems to be the first version when they added int128_t. I need to use bit shifting and I have run out of room for some bit fields.

Edit: It might be because I'm on a 32-bit computer, there's no way to have it for a 32-bit computer (Intel Atom), is there? I wouldn't care if it generated tricky slow machine code if I would work as expected with bit shifting.
